The Shine Dome 

Built in 1959, this concrete, hemispherical building hosts conferences & private functions. Australian Academy of Science’s Shine Dome and its custom-designed furniture were created to reflect the inquiring and innovative nature of science. It was the first Canberra building to be added to the National Heritage List, for its historical and architectural significance.

A Canberra landmark since its construction in 1959, the Shine Dome has received numerous awards and is one of seven projects the Royal Australian Institute of Architects has nominated to the World Register of Significant Twentieth Century Architecture.

 

Over the decades, the dome has captured imaginations and inspired the authorship of a number of memoirs. The book, ’A big bold simple concept’, was commissioned for the 50th anniversary of the Dome’s construction. It documents the design and construction of the Academy’s building in Canberra.
